**Audit Item 14 — SeatScape Renderer Accessibility Pass.** Plugin authors extending the SeatScape seat-map renderer for the Veldmoor Playhouse must verify that every interactive seat element exposes a row, seat number, and pricing tier to assistive technology. Confirm zoom levels preserve focus order and that color is never the sole availability indicator. Record findings before requesting certification from the accountable reviewer named below.

named custodian: Brivan Eliath Quenox Frador

Handover note — Webhook delivery retries (Pushlane service)

For future maintainers: retries use exponential backoff starting at 30s, capped at 6 attempts. Delivery is at-least-once; consumers must dedupe on event ID. Dead-lettered events land in the holdback queue and need manual replay via the ops console. Console access requires unlocking the replay vault, so here is the recovery passphrase:

unlock words, fafop-hawep: briwyn-oliix-sorox

# Heads up: this is the new reset flow, post-revamp.
#
# The old Fernwick flow emailed a six-digit code with no throttle,
# which... yeah. We now issue single-use signed tokens, rate-limit
# requests per account, and expire everything aggressively. If a
# token is reused we invalidate the whole chain and force a fresh
# request. Don't loosen these without talking to the auth crew first.
# The knobs that control all of this live right below.

tuning table, yajog-yahof:
BUDGETS = {
    "lamvan": 303,
    "wenox": 460,
    "fenvan": 525,
}

Q: The Inkwright spooler service is backing up again — what do I do first? A: Don't restart it right away. Nine times out of ten it's a stuck job from the Maplebrook office printers holding the queue lock. Drain the stuck job, confirm the queue depth drops, and only then consider a restart. If the lock won't release, escalate to the Fenwick platform channel. Step-by-step instructions live on the internal runbook page.

wiki page, fahaf-yagag: https://confluence.qorvellabs.internal/pages/display/pages/display